CARLYLE IMPLEMENT AND IRON WORKS CHRISTCHURCH. CARLYW PATENT DISC HARROWS. WE lir, ve introduced 'further valuable Improvements for this season, and our Harrow is still far in advance of competition. The Discs are now fixed independent of the Axle, and there is no possibility of their working loose. We have also reduced the number of wearing parts, and thereby simplified and strengthened the Harrow considerably. —600 SETS NOW IN USE. THE CARLISLE PLOUGHS Are SECOND TO NONE for Strength, Durability* Quality of Work, Lightness of Draught, Economy of Wearing Parts, etc. Our, Improved Patent Conical Skeith Centro i* now simply perfection. We have succeeded in prilling all the wearing surfaces, and reducing the paits ( in Weight and size. THE CARLYLE IRON WINDMILL is (he only satisfactory Windmill in the market. Bead the following TestimonialOroua Downs. Manawaiu, lltli January, 1887. Dear Sirs, —I have greet pleasure in testifying to the excellence of your Carlyle Windmills. I; have been using them (or the last five years. I have no less than nine of them erected on this estate, and I am sending you an order for three more, which I think is sufficient to show that I highly approve of them. —I am, stc., J. MCLENNAN.
